Skanondaga Heights Market Data
| Metric | Value | Source |
|---|---|---|
| Median Home Price | $397K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Gross Rent | $1K/mo |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Household Income | $101K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Homeownership Rate | 81.7%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Renter-Occupied | 18.3%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Rental Vacancy Rate | 2.5%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Market Type | Seller's |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Primary ZIP Code | 13152 |
